Transaction 18958a8a12fe3ea21cce159df4abfc386af6573a09215cc50913b2a8f39b2aa9
1 Input
2 Outputs
- 18958a8a12fe3ea21cce159df4abfc386af6573a09215cc50913b2a8f39b2aa9:0
- 18958a8a12fe3ea21cce159df4abfc386af6573a09215cc50913b2a8f39b2aa9:1
value 41383
address 3JKkTp8R3J2PqknNQjYd2DKFuNJEmPtUVo
value 30542728
address 37KtBgUKu2PW6Fm7tVwZmyirL9QPfYpHzr